75% Superwash Blue Faced Leiceter wool 25% Nylon
425m per 100g
This yarn is perfect for socks and other objects knit on a tight gauge that need to handle hard use. Blue Faced Leiceter is a wool with long glossy fibers that are very well suited for this type of use and with the added nylon for your hard work to really last as long as possible.
Ratatosk is the name of the squirrel that lives in Yggdrasil, the “world tree”. It relays news and insults between the serpent Nidhogg, who lives in the roots, and the eagle, who lives in the top branches of Yggdrasil.
Ratatosk is the squirrel
who there shall run
On the ash-tree Yggdrasil;
From above the words
of the eagle he bears,
And tells them to Nithhogg beneath.
Grimnesmàl (the sayings of Grimnir)
